Understanding Volatility and RTP
When approaching any slot game, including the captivating world of joker's jewels themed games, it’s essential to understand two key concepts: volatility (also known as variance) and Return to Player (RTP). Volatility refers to the risk level associated with the game. High volatility games offer the potential for large payouts but are less frequent, requiring a greater bankroll to withstand periods of losing spins. Low volatility games provide more frequent, smaller wins, offering a more consistent but less dramatic gaming experience. RTP, expressed as a percentage, represents the average amount of money a game is expected to return to players over a long period. A higher RTP generally indicates a more favorable game for the player, although it’s important to remember that RTP is a theoretical average and does not guarantee any specific outcomes.

The Role of Bonus Features and Cascading Reels
Modern slot games often incorporate a variety of bonus features to enhance gameplay and increase the potential for winning. These features can range from free spins and multipliers to interactive bonus rounds and pick-and-win games. These elements not only add excitement but also provide opportunities to significantly boost payouts. Cascading reels, also known as avalanche reels, are a particularly popular feature. In this mechanic, winning symbols disappear from the reels, and new symbols cascade down to fill the empty spaces. This process can continue multiple times on a single spin, creating the potential for multiple wins from a single bet. Cascading reels add an element of unexpected thrill and sustained engagement.
